Noun

Tilo
dafara

Jam'i
babu (none)

f

  1. saliva drooling from a sick person (viewed as a sign of impending death). <> yawun haɗe da majina da ke fitowa daga bakin mara lafiya.
  2. wani tsiro a daji mai ruwa mai yauƙi. <> a plant found in the wild that has a thick watery substance.
